Why Houston?
Northland is located in Houston, Texas, the fourth largest city in the United States and home to major corporations and medical centers. Houston is a hub for key industries—technology, oil and gas, banking and finance, law, and medicine—and our city has world-renowned fine arts, athletics and academic institutions, including Rice University, currently ranked #17 in national universities. Houston is also a travel hub with two major airports, including George Bush International Airport, and is easily accessible by most major international cities.
Northland is located only 15 miles from George Bush International Airport, 20 miles from Downtown Houston, and only 70 miles from Galveston. We are about 3 hours away from three other major cities: Dallas, San Antonio, and Austin.
Houston is one of the most international and diverse places in America, with countless opportunities for students to study, explore new activities, prepare for university, and connect to potential future employers. Begin the Application Process Each international applicant must first complete an interview with Northland’s International Program Director, Elizabeth Chavez. This is an opportunity for us to meet you, to get an initial understanding of your English comprehension level, and to ensure that you would be a good fit in the Northland community.To schedule an interview with the International Program Director, click here.All interviews are conducted via Zoom. Since Northland receives international applicants from all around the world, all interviews are scheduled in Central Standard Time.
